New Data Protection policies

The University is committed to protecting the privacy rights of those whose data it processes.

Whether we are processing the personal data of our students, staff, research participants or anyone else who has entrusted us with their personal data, we do so responsibly and in compliance with the law.

If we fail to meet those obligations, we lose the trust of those whose data we process. We also risk reputational damage, enforcement action and potential financial penalty.

To support staff in maintaining high standards around data protection, the Information Compliance Office has launched three new policies:

  1.  Data Protection Policy 
  2.  Data Breach Policy 
  3.  Data Rights Policy
